TRANSCRIPT OF CARTOON
This cartoon has four panels, each featuring the same two characters: A representative of the Republican party, a middle-aged man wearing a jacket and tie, and a diabetic with spiky red hair. I’ll call them “Tie” and “Spike.”
PANEL 1
We’re in a grassy area, with trees and a fence in the background. Tie is speaking to Spike sternly, and Spike replies anxiously.
TIE: You know how much insulin costs? Throwing freeloaders like you off Medicaid will save tons of money!
SPIKE: But if I can’t afford insulin, I’ll wind up in the E.R., which costs a lot more!
PANEL 2
As they continue talking, they are now in the E.R..
SPIKE: Since I won’t be able to pay, the costs will be passed onto hospitals, other patients, and state governments.
PANEL 3
Spike is now in a hospice bed, wearing a patient’s gown. Tie is by Spike’s bedside, still speaking sternly.
SPIKE: And the sicker I get, the less I can work and contribute to the economy, right?
TIE: Maybe that’s all true.
PANEL 4
We’re back in the grassy area. Tie is grinning hugely and skipping. Spike has been replaced by a gravestone marked “R.I.P.”.
TIE: But have you considered how huge my tax cuts will be?
